Class TranslateResource


  • @Path("/translate")
    public class TranslateResource
    extends Object
    • Constructor Detail

      • TranslateResource

        public TranslateResource​(ServerStatus serverStatus,
                                 long timeoutMillis)
    • Method Detail

      • translate

        @PUT
        @POST
        @Path("/all/{translator}/{src}/{dest}")
        @Consumes("*/*")
        @Produces("text/plain")
        public String translate​(InputStream is,
                                @PathParam("translator")
                                String translator,
                                @PathParam("src")
                                String sLang,
                                @PathParam("dest")
                                String dLang)
                         throws org.apache.tika.exception.TikaException,
                                IOException
        Throws:
        org.apache.tika.exception.TikaException
        IOException
      • autoTranslate

        @PUT
        @POST
        @Path("/all/{translator}/{dest}")
        @Consumes("*/*")
        @Produces("text/plain")
        public String autoTranslate​(InputStream is,
                                    @PathParam("translator")
                                    String translator,
                                    @PathParam("dest")
                                    String dLang)
                             throws org.apache.tika.exception.TikaException,
                                    IOException
        Throws:
        org.apache.tika.exception.TikaException
        IOException